Output 8e90266c19fa531fc03f87bb56bac3bf89ee1e441b9b775a195657a3f79d99ee:0

value
2000089489
script pubkey
OP_0 OP_PUSHBYTES_20 5cc942a643b87ce9a8abee7c977d7e2f38edab55
address
tb1qtny59fjrhp7wn29tae7fwlt79uuwm264d3hdy0
transaction
8e90266c19fa531fc03f87bb56bac3bf89ee1e441b9b775a195657a3f79d99ee
confirmations
109588
spent
true